How much do client services associate j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 20, 2026, the average hourly pay for client services associate in Westbrook, ME is $22.79,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$17.36 and $25.43 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a client services associate?

A client services associate is responsible for supporting financial advisors by providing a number of sales and support functions. In this career, you are typically employed by financial or wealth management organizations. Your job duties include giving quotes to customers, keeping records of investment transactions, building customer portfolios, and handling general customer service requests. Qualifications include experience with stocks, bonds and other investments, and strong customer service and oral communication skills.

What does a client services associate do?

A Client Services Associate acts as a key point of contact between a company and its clients, ensuring that clients receive high-quality service and support. They handle client inquiries, resolve issues, assist with account management, and coordinate with other departments to fulfill client needs. Their goal is to maintain positive client relationships and help ensure client satisfaction, often working in industries like finance, marketing, or consulting.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a client services associate?

To thrive as a Client Services Associate, you need strong interpersonal skills, customer service experience, and often a bachelor's degree in business or a related field. Familiarity with CRM software, Microsoft Office Suite, and sometimes industry-specific platforms is typically required. Exceptional communication, organizational abilities, and a proactive attitude help you stand out in this client-facing role. These skills and qualities are essential for building client trust, efficiently resolving issues, and supporting overall business growth.

What are some common challenges faced by client services associates, and how can they be overcome?

Client Services Associates often manage multiple client accounts simultaneously, which can lead to competing priorities and tight deadlines. Effective time management and clear communication are essential for balancing these demands. Building strong relationships with clients and proactively addressing their concerns hel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ures satisfaction. Collaboration with internal teams, such as sales and operations, is also key to efficiently resolving client issues and delivering high-quality service.

What is the difference between Client Services Associate vs Customer Support Specialist?

AspectClient Services AssociateCustomer Support Specialist
Required C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; some roles may prefer associate degreesHigh school diploma or equivalent; technical certifications optional
Work EnvironmentOffice setting, client-facing interactions, account managementCall centers, help desks, online support platforms
Employer & Industry UsageFinancial services, consulting, professional servicesRetail, tech companies, service industries
Common Search & Comparison IntentUnderstanding roles in client relationship managementAssisting customers with issues or inquiries

The main difference is that Client Services Associates focus on managing client accounts and building relationships in professional settings, while Customer Support Specialists primarily handle customer inquiries and technical issues. Both roles require strong communication skills but differ in their scope and work environment.
